要在网站上播放Youtuve视频,需要什么

时间:2019-06-13 21:52:51

标签: html youtube

要在网站页面上播放YouTube视频,需要做什么?我有一个网站,Youtube视频在一个页面上可以正常播放,但在另一页面上,不能播放同一视频。

当我将鼠标悬停在播放按钮上时,该页面会从黑色变为红色。

在页面上,当我将鼠标悬停在播放按钮上时,播放按钮不会更改其外观。

当我在无法运行的页面上按播放时,什么也没发生。

我的网站是使用Coldfusion构建的

1 个答案:

答案 0 :(得分:0)

谁能解释以下原因解决了我的问题。

在无效页面上,用于显示Youtube视频的代码如下:

<p><span class="fr-video fr-fvc fr-dvb fr-draggable" contenteditable="false" draggable="true">
<iframe width="640" height="360" src="https://www.youtube.com/embed/ztr-AS-xkDQ?wmode=transparent" frameborder="0" allowfullscreen="" class="fr-draggable"></iframe>
</span></p>

在工作正常的页面上,..代码没有被带有fr-video类的包围。

我在其中一个样式表中发现其中包含以下内容,这些内容仅在不起作用的页面上使用:

.fr-element .fr-video::after {
  position: absolute;
  content: '';
  z-index: 1;
  top: 0;
  left: 0;
  right: 0;
  bottom: 0;
  cursor: pointer;
  display: block;
  background: rgba(0, 0, 0, 0);
}

如果我删除了:

bottom: 0;

然后,Youtube视频正常加载并播放。

任何人都可以解释为什么这可以解决我的问题